The Dogtag Certificate System is an enterprise-class open source Certificate Authority (CA). It is a full-featured system, and has been hardened by real-world deployments. It supports all aspects of certificate lifecycle management, including key archival, OCSP and smartcard management, and much more.
There are 6 different subsystems included in the Dogtag PKI suite:
- Certificate Authority (CA) subsystem
- Key Recovery Authority (KRA) subsystem
- Online Certificate Status Protocol (OCSP) subsystem
- Token Key Service (TKS) subsystem
- Token Processing System (TPS) subsystem
- ACME Responder

To install the whole Dogtag PKI suite:
sudo dnf install dogtag-pkiTo install individual subsystems:
sudo dnf install pki-ca pki-kra pki-ocsp pki-tks pki-tpsTo install web UI theme packages:
sudo dnf install dogtag-pki-themeAfter successful installation of the packages, follow the below steps to deploy intended subsystems:

sudo dnf install dnf-plugins-core rpm-build git
# NOTE: Use the intendended branch name instead of "master" to pull right dependency version
sudo dnf copr enable @pki/master
sudo dnf builddep pki.specAfter successfully installing the prerequisites, the project can be built with a one-line command:
./build.shThe built RPMS will be placed in ~/build/pki/ directory.
